A 3‐Year Split‐Mouth Randomized Non‐Inferiority Controlled Trial Comparing Cement‐Retained Monolithic CAD‐CAM Zirconia and Lithium Disilicate Crowns for Single Posterior Implant Restorations

Key points

  • Split-mouth design in 112 posterior implant sites (56 patients) compared zirconia vs. lithium disilicate monolithic crowns over 36 months.
  • Primary outcome: 98.2 % survival for zirconia, 96.4 % for lithium disilicate—no statistically significant difference in technical or biologic complications.
  • Marginal bone loss averaged 0.42 mm (zirconia) vs. 0.48 mm (lithium disilicate), below the 0.5 mm threshold for clinical concern.
  • Results support either material for posterior single-unit implant crowns, giving clinicians evidence to align material selection with patient occlusion, esthetics, and cost.
